Существует легенда о сотворении Рима.. . о братьях близнецах Ромуле и Реме. Они по легенде основали на Палатинском холме на берегу Тибра город. и назвали его ( Рим)



Why Rome is Called "Rome"
The name "Rome" is believed to have originated from the Etruscan word "Ruma," which means "teat," referring to the shape of Palatine Hill, where the city was founded. The name "Roma" is also associated with the legend of Romulus and Remus, the twin brothers who were central figures in Rome's foundation myth. According to the legend, Romulus became the first king of Rome after killing his brother Remus. The name "Roma" is thought to be derived from Romulus's name.
The city of Rome was originally settled on the Palatine Hill, one of the Seven Hills of Rome. Over time, it grew to become one of the most powerful and influential cities in the ancient world, eventually giving rise to the Roman Empire.
The exact origins of the name "Rome" may have multiple influences, including linguistic, historical, and mythological factors.
